Here are just a few of the apple varieties that we have collected. In total I think we got about 4,000 lb. of apples
Viv's Red: (Most years a bit more red from what I hear) medium tanin, medium acid, but pretty sweet a nice eating apple.After Bill gave the Viv's Red tree a good shake.
Egremont Russet: Very Aromatic! Great for eating and will blend well for cider!
Viv's Black. High Tanins and Acid. Not much in the way of eating but should make good cider.
